Transaction 40164e257a5fd88257142659f2ac6d39ebe568586c2c6ec5ddfbb952f7109007

61 Input
2 Outputs
  • 40164e257a5fd88257142659f2ac6d39ebe568586c2c6ec5ddfbb952f7109007:0
  • value  1398827
    address  33yjSQGE9yND6UZQfjigdTp3vQ8r2aZT8a
  • 40164e257a5fd88257142659f2ac6d39ebe568586c2c6ec5ddfbb952f7109007:1
  • value  7895719472
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s